Transaction 7cc20e1738672f4c925367d7a26c17545a62f3ccaf2afaabdbf5a8267f862237

3 Input
2 Outputs
  • 7cc20e1738672f4c925367d7a26c17545a62f3ccaf2afaabdbf5a8267f862237:0
  • value  14329053
    address  3PwU2hfUnKSp1XfkU3oiBkmB6YKTAHuZ9S
  • 7cc20e1738672f4c925367d7a26c17545a62f3ccaf2afaabdbf5a8267f862237:1
  • value  1431948
    address  35zvbVeSYBtHdE3mhf4DPLDZPqqu3V6jBj